Golf Digest's selection of Peggy Ference made the challenge to break 100 ever so elusive once again as she shot 118 at Pebble Beach. Anyone remotely surprised? Gotta think that they could choose someone to break 100. Wahlberg shot 97 and I've seen him play. He ain't got that much game.

Pretty sure she was a 4.9 or around there and from the articles I read on a few holes she couldn't even reach the red tees because they had her playing from the tips. She made one par the whole round, on the 12th hole, and jumped up and down hugging her caddy (Corey Pavin I think) like she had won something. They said the course was playing like a par 78 for her, but still, 40 strokes over that? I think having a woman in it playing from the mens tees was more of a publicity stunt this year than it was in years past. Another article said she was only driving around 200-225 yards. How do they ever expect someone to break 100 playing a 7,000+ yard course maxing out at 225 with their driver?
